But before you jump into our review below it’s worth having a think about what you may need from your next weather station – here’s some key areas to consider:
- Accuracy – Consider how precise your weather station needs to be. If your livelihood depends on super accurate tracking make sure it’s very precise but if you’re just a hobbyist or gardener, some variance may not be a problem for you day-to-day.
- Functionality – Weather stations come equipped with a wide range of different indicators, tracking everything from wind speed to temperature. Ensure if there’s some specific measurements you need to know, whether that be for growing crops or managing garden projects, the weather station you chose can track them for you!
- Durability – Weather stations are an investment so you want to ensure you make the most of it! As an example, if you’re measuring somewhere that’s exposed to strong winds, sleet or hail make sure you invest in a robust enough station to keep your tracking up and running over the long term.
- Technology – Modern weather stations now vary in their use of technology, with many offering the ability to track the elements remotely from the comfort of your home or office. If you want something with remote monitoring built in, a wireless monitoring device is a must have when making your buying decision.
Best Solar Weather Station For Home: ProWeatherStation TP3000WC
If you’re looking for a great and easy to use solar weather station for home then look no further than the ProWeatherStation TP3000WC!
It comes with a 7-in-one sensor array providing an anemometer, a wind direction meter, a temp/humidity sensor, a rain gauge & a solar/light sensor! So as you can see, a great array of options for keeping an eye on the elements!
It’s super easy to setup with its main power drive coming from it’s solar sensor array all whilst maintaining a battery backup when things go dark!

Best Value For Money: La Crosse Technology S81120-INT
We start our roundup with the La Crosse Technology S81120-INT which is a fantastic entry point for anyone wanting solar-powered readings at a bargain price.
It comes with the functionality to track temperature, wind speed and humidity, giving you the ability to set specific alerts around those metrics.
It comes with a full colour digital display with a range of over 100m. It’s fully solar-powered including a rechargeable battery so you’re good to go right out of the box!

Best for Farming/Business – AcuRite Atlas 01007M
For those looking to keep a tight gaze on the local environment to inform your livelihoods you’ll need something super reliable. The AcuRite Atlas 01007M is a great choice for those that need to keep tracking accurately 24/7.
It comes with sensors for wind, rain, temperature & humidity as well as a super handy lightening detector equipping you will all the stats you need to work and operate safely.
AcuRite are also a US based company offering first class customer support both in terms of setup and maintenance as well as for any issues which may arise!

Best Wireless Solar Weather Station: La Crosse Technology V40A-PRO-INT
For those that want to monitor their local conditions on the move, you’ll need a station that connects into your home network and mobile phone. One of the best on the market for connectivity is the La Crosse V40A-PRO-INT.
Boasting a good range of measurements including rain, wind, heat and dew point, the La Crosse isn’t sacrificing connectivity for functionality even though additional sensors are sold separately.
But the power of this station is in it’s ability to connect into your daily life utilise the ‘La Crosse View’ app. The app gives you all your data right at your finger tips, allowing you to look back at trends alongside tailor weather predictions for your area as well as across the country! Best for Accuracy – Davis Instruments DAV-6152EU
If you’re in the market for a product that’s going to provide best in class accuracy then the Davis Instruments DAV-6152EU is definitely the weather station we recommend!
The power of accuracy comes from it’s ability to crunch many sets of complex data, working with other stations and repeaters within a 300m radius to aggregate and average readings!
Alongside this, it also provides you, as the reader, with the most accurate updates, feeding back into the display every 2.5 seconds, up to 10x faster than most other models on the market!
Functionality wise you’re getting a rain collector, temperature and humidity sensors and an anemometer all in one package, with a cabled version also available for even greater accuracy!

Best All Rounder – ECOWITT HP3501
If you don’t need a super high level of accuracy, want some decent connectivity and a good range of functionality the ECOWITT HP3501 is the best all rounder we’ve found on the market.
With measurement functionality covering wind, rain, temperature, dew point, pressure, humidity and solar UV you have most of the bases covered out of the box with this station!
Put this together with 16 second update accuracy, a high quality colour display and connectivity to ECOWITT’s ‘WS View’ app you’ll get high quality readings wherever you happen to be!
